Description:

A short, plain English summary of the nine roles public contributors can play when they get involved with health organisations. This is a summary of some of the findings from our open source BMJ Open article "Developing a typology of the roles public contributors undertake to establish legitimacy: a longitudinal case study of patient and public involvement in a health network" which is free to read here https://bmjopen.bmj.com/content/10/5/e033370.full
